What was the deal with Tulane & the SEC?

I heard they left on their own. Which, if true, is dumber than the big east turning down $1B from espn.

Here’s a story from Tulane’s official site explaining their voluntary withdrawal from the SEC in 1966. Short version is that they had cut back on athletic scholarships and were getting killed in football. The SEC wasn’t awash in TV money back then.
